Midlothian Rotary President Cammy Jackson is shown here with Brad Pelo and the children's library book being donated in his honor after his presentation on Tuesday afternoon, May 23rd.
 
Brad Pelo told about the beginning of the idea for this project - a Dallas Jenkins short film - and the pathway taken to bring this to fruition. Seven seasons are planned and production is into the fourth season.
 
 
He showed a video taken by a very maneuverable drone of the Midlothian lot setup - quite interesting to see the various sets. Most of the "filming" is done at the Camp Hoblitzelle site now, with some in Utah. The series is "crowdfunded," so money raised by many people interested in seeing this series be successful and encouraging others to "pay it forward."
